Problem with starry sky image

hello.

ive been creating a starry sky image.
ive done everything correct in creating it but when i save all the layers to a flattened single layer i lose the adjustment layers.

new document-fill with black-add noise-levels adjustment layer-adjust sliders-flatten image to a single layer.

for some reason the levels adjustment layer which creates the stars effect is lost.

any help would be appreciated.
